Fire Engulfs Garden Sheds in Halle, Fire Department Responds

DE2 hr ago

The fire department in Halle, Germany, was called to the scene of a fire involving garden sheds. The blaze required the deployment of emergency services to extinguish the flames. Further details regarding the cause of the fire or the extent of the damage were not immediately available. The incident occurred in Halle, a city in the German state of Saxony-Anhalt. Firefighters worked to contain and put out the fire, ensuring the safety of the surrounding area. The event caused traffic disruptions as emergency vehicles responded to the scene. The specific location within Halle where the garden sheds were situated has not been disclosed. Investigations into the origin of the fire are likely to follow.
